Desiccant Dehumidification Cost in West Jordan, UT

The cost of desiccant dehumidification services can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in West Jordan, UT. Our estimates typically range from $500 to $2,500, depending on the specific needs of your home.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Planning $100 – $500 Severity of damage and size of affected area
Desiccant Dehumidification System Installation $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area and type of equipment needed
Dehumidification and Drying $500 – $2,000 Severity of damage and size of affected area
Final Inspection and Cleaning $100 – $500 Size of affected area and type of equipment needed
Follow-up and Maintenance $100 – $500 Frequency of follow-up appointments and type of equipment needed
